BNP, allies rally against ‘genocide, torture’ Monday

Opposition BNP-led 18-party alliance will stage rallies in upazila, district and metropolitan cities on Monday protesting government’s ‘genocide, torture’.
Joint Secretary General of the opposition BNP Ruhul Kabir Rizvi made the announcement at a press briefing on Saturday afternoon.
Ruhul Kabir Rizvi told the journalists: “The government is torturing people by using activists of Chhatra and Juba League.”
The press briefing was also attended, among others, by BNP Joint Secretary General Salauddin Ahmed, Organising Secretary Moshiur Rahman and Assistant Law Affairs Secretary Advocate Sanaullah Mia.
Besides, Chhatra Dal, student wing of the opposition party, will stage demonstrations demanding unconditional release of its leaders and activists and restoration of the caretaker government provision to the constitution. banglanews24.com
